Calendar Widget Reorder

Overview

The Calendar Widget Reorder feature in Stack allows you to customize the sequence of steps in the calendar widget. You can choose the order of the Date & Time Selector, the Form, and Payments (if enabled). Decide whether the Date & Time Selector or the Form appears first, which then determines the placement of the Payment step. This feature is beneficial for businesses aiming to gather lead information even if an appointment isn't booked.

Configuring the Widget Order

Note: This feature is available only for the NEO Widget.

  1. Navigate to Calendar Settings and select your calendar.
  2. Go to Forms & Payments.
  3. Drag and reorder the Date & Time Selector and Form to your desired sequence.
  4. Click Save to apply your changes.

How Does This Work?

If the Date Picker is First and the Form is Second:

  • Process: The user selects a date, fills out the form, and schedules the meeting.
  • Outcome: The appointment is booked, a contact is created in the system, and the form is submitted.

If the Form is First and the Date Picker is Second:

  • Process: The user fills out the form first.
  • Outcome: A contact is created immediately after the form submission. If the user then books an appointment, it is added to the system.

How Do Payments Work?

If payments are enabled, the creation of the appointment is contingent on the payment status.

  • Payment Process:
    • Duration: The user has 10 minutes to complete the payment.
    • Outcome: If payment is successful within 10 minutes, the appointment is booked. If not, the slot is reopened for others to book.

FAQs

Q: What happens when someone clicks back and submits the form again?
A: If the form is resubmitted within the same session, multiple submissions will appear. The details from the latest submission will update the contact.

Q: What happens to my form submission workflows?
A: If the form is first, workflows are triggered as soon as the form is submitted. If the form is second, workflows trigger only if the appointment is successfully booked.

Q: What happens to my appointment workflows?
A: If payment is disabled, workflows trigger as soon as the appointment is booked. If payment is enabled, workflows trigger only after payment completion, as the appointment is booked only with successful payment.

Q: I can't see the slot on the booking widget, and I don't have an appointment scheduled for the same time. Why is this happening?
A: This may occur if someone has selected a slot but hasn't completed the payment. The slot is held for 10 minutes. If payment is completed, the appointment is booked and visible in the calendar. If not, the slot is released and available for others.
